密码编码学与网络安全第五版 向金海 04-对称密码-aes-rc4教学 灯片.pptVIP

  • 3
  • 0
  • 约7.56千字
  • 约 63页
  • 2018-12-09 发布于天津
  • 举报

密码编码学与网络安全第五版 向金海 04-对称密码-aes-rc4教学 灯片.ppt

密码编码学与网络安全第五版 向金海 04-对称密码-aes-rc4教学 灯片.ppt

* * 字节代换(Substitute Bytes )变换 S-盒 代替表(S-盒)是可逆的,是一个16×16的矩阵。 * * * * 字节代换(Substitute Bytes )变换 例子 * * S盒的构造 初始化 元素求逆:在GF中求逆 元素置换 其中: =2 * * 行移位(shift Row)变换 正向和逆向变换 * * 行移位(shift Row)变换 例子 * 华中农业大学信息学院 * 列混淆(Mix Column)变换 正向和逆向变换 代替操作,将状态的列看作有限域GF(28)上的4维向量并被有限域GF(28)上的一个固定可逆方阵A乘 乘法是GF(28)定义中定义的,素多项式为: m(x) =x8+x4+x3+x+1 * 华中农业大学信息学院 * * 华中农业大学信息学院 * 列混淆(Mix Column)变换 例子 * 华中农业大学信息学院 * 轮密钥加(Add Round Key)变换 一个简单地按位异或的操作 * 华中农业大学信息学院 * 内部函数的功能小结 SubBytes 的目的是为了得到一个非线性的代换密码。对于分析密码抗差分分析来说,非线性是一个重要的性质。 ShiftRows 和MixColumns 的目的是获得明文消息分组在不同位置上的字节混合。 AddRoundKey 给出了消息分布所需的秘密

文档评论(0)

1亿VIP精品文档

相关文档